Llanishen High School has today become the one millionth customer of supply teaching agency, New Directions Education. The school made a booking for a cover supply teacher last week and hit the one millionth day booked for the agency.

Established in 1999, New Directions Education fast became the largest recruitment and training provider throughout Wales. In 2012 the business was awarded the ‘All Wales Agreement’ for the supply of staff to the education sector.

Speaking about the winning school, Gary Williams, Director of Business Development said ‘How fitting that a school based in Cardiff should be our millionth day booked. We now work throughout the UK, but we are always conscious of our grass roots in Wales. Both the school and the supply teacher will receive an iPad by way of a thank you’.

Llanishen High and the supply teacher will be presented with their iPad at the New Directions Education Inspirational Teaching Awards. The event is being held on Friday, 20th June 2014 at the Mecure Holland House Hotel in Cardiff to celebrate the outstanding achievements of individuals from the education sector across Wales.

Speaking about being the millionth customer Claire Wright, Cover Manager for Llanishen High said ‘That is fantastic news. How very exciting. We look forward to receiving the iPad and celebrating with colleagues from across the education sector in June’.

Since New Directions Education opened its doors, they have registered over 27,000 supply staff for the education sector and have worked with over 1,200 schools and colleges across the UK.
